CLIFTON, Va. – There are now 23 offers on the table for Oxon Hill (Md.) four-star wide receiver Daniel George. But as George said Sunday at the Washington, DC stop of Nike’s The Opening Regionals, a few of those schools are getting more attention than others.
Since the first of the year, George has taken visits to Penn State, Maryland, West Virginia and Virginia Tech. A few aspects of those visits particularly stood out. And as of now, George is eyeing a time frame for a decision.
“I would say, Penn State, Maryland and Virginia Tech mostly stood out,” George said. “With Penn State, it’s because of Coach Gattis, the relationship I have with him and Coach Franklin. Maryland, it’s the home school and I know everybody there. Virginia Tech stands out because of Coach Fuente and the receiver situation they have over there.”
